Full fund details
- Objective
- Seeks daily investment results that correspond to the inverse (-1x) of the daily performance of the MSCI EAFE Index.
- Strategy
- Invests in financial instruments to achieve inverse exposure to large and mid-cap companies across 21 developed market countries, excluding the U.S. and Canada. The Fund uses derivatives, primarily swap agreements, to gain this exposure and rebalances daily to maintain the inverse target.
